Leader: Young environment leader hosts power talk

YOUNG Environmentalist of the Year Matthew Wright will speak about options for ‘base-load’ power and living without coal or fossil fuels at an environmental forum in Balwyn North.

The Brunswick resident, who is also executive director of Fitzroy-based Beyond Zero Emissions, said there were “massive” roll-outs of renewable energy going on in economies less dominated by fossil fuel interests, including China, Spain, Germany and the UK.

“Australians are missing out on a gateway of opportunities in the 21st century energy revolution, and are instead stuck in the 19th century fossil fuel economy,” Mr Wright said.
